Banks keep interest rates unchanged amid low loan demand
Banks keep interest rates unchanged amid low loan demand

KATHMANDU, Feb 13: Most commercial banks in Nepal have kept their interest rates unchanged for Falgun (mid-February to mid-March), with 18 out of 20 banks maintaining the same rates as last month. Only one bank raised its rates, while another lowered them.

IT-related goods and services worth Rs 28 billion exported in six months
IT-related goods and services worth Rs 28 billion exported i...

Nepal’s export of Information Technology (IT) goods and services is gradually increasing. In the first six months of the current Fiscal Year 2024/25, IT related goods and services worth over Rs 28.5 billion were exported from Nepal.
